Study of Flows in Particulate Filters in Biodiesel Emissions

Abstract

This work proposes an alternative approach to the gas flow analysis in DPFs, Diesel Particulate Filters; by modeling the problem through the Stream FunctionVorticity formulation instead of the traditional Navier-Stokes formulation. Along with that, it’s also proposed the replacement of the algebraic formulation of porous media through Darcy’s Equation by a geometrical one, imposing different geometries ofobstaculesalongthemodel’smesh.
